Your danger of stepping into an auto incident goes up significantly after you've applied marijuana. "Cannabis surely influences your capacity to push, just like alcohol does, however , you make different errors," Hill claims.
3 Marijuana and Alcoholic beverages consumed alongside one another will be the most frequently encountered compound mix implicated in car or truck accidents. Although the mechanisms aren’t entirely clear, beyond the apparent challenges released by combining two unique intoxicants, Alcoholic beverages could increase the level of cannabis’s Key psychoactive ingredient, THC, during the blood.3

You will find a escalating usage of novel psychoactive substances made up of synthetic cannabinoids. Synthetic cannabinoid merchandise have effects much like These of natural cannabis, but, these medicine are more potent and dangerous, and have been affiliated with dangerous adverse effects.
